Doorbell Repair Cost Overview

Typical price ranges for doorbell repair projects can vary depending on the complexity and type of system. The following estimates provide a general idea of potential costs involved.

$100 - $300: Basic repair or replacement of standard doorbell components

$300 - $800: More extensive repairs involving wiring, chimes, or smart doorbell systems

Project Type Typical Range
Standard Doorbell Repair $100 - $200
Wireless Doorbell Fix $100 - $300
Smart Doorbell Repair $300 - $800
Wiring Troubleshooting $150 - $500
Chime Replacement $100 - $300
Complete Doorbell System Upgrade $500 - $1,200

What Affects the Cost of Doorbell Repair

Several factors can influence the overall expense of repairing a doorbell. Understanding these elements can help in comparing options and estimating project costs.

  • Materials: The type and quality of replacement parts or new components required.
  • Size and Scope: The complexity of the repair, including the number of components involved.
  • Labor Complexity: The difficulty of accessing and repairing the doorbell system.
  • Permitting: Whether local permits are needed for certain repairs or upgrades.
  • Additional Features or Extras: Optional upgrades such as video capabilities or smart home integration.
